Saxophonist, jazz musician and composer of film music and jingles for film and television advertisements – Bruno Spoerri has a broad repertoire. In 1965, Spoerri became one of the first in Switzerland to produce electronic music. The pioneer invited swissinfo into his Zurich studio where he talked about his experience with electronic music that covers nearly half a century.
